in Ng's statement, he comments on the acro your speaking of... its a red planet, however its lost its greenish base, which it does in high light, and as i have (8) 54 watt ATI's over a 75g, i am a bit on the high side lol... my bulbs are now no more than 6 and a half months old, 6 are, other two were replaced in may... I plan on replacing them all again within 2 months time... i like my bulbs fresh :) the red planet was also actually bleached out pretty badly when i actually replaced jus two bulbs in may as i jus mentioned... so its doing quite well now, and i think that is the color i am i gonna get out of it from here out...

How are you supplementing potassium? and what else are you dosing?
 
How are you supplementing potassium? and what else are you dosing?

I only dose brs two part daily, and water change 5g's every other day as mentioned in the other thread... ill toss a few ounces of brs magnesium once a week... but that is it... potassium and other trace elements are taken care of by the 5 gallon water changes every other day in which i use instant ocean... i have about 135 total gallons of water in my system...
